iodymoon 发表于 2015-10-10 17:50:52

salt-stack pillar中传中文报错

使用salt启动一个应用时,参数需要传入一个中文,salt总是报错:
Rendering SLS 'test.start' failed: Jinja error: 'ascii' codec can't decode byte 0xe5 in position 14: ordinal not in range(128)
Traceback (most recent call last):
File "/usr/lib/python2.6/site-packages/salt/utils/templates.py", line 286, in render_jinja_tmpl
    output = template.render(**unicode_context)
File "/usr/lib64/python2.6/site-packages/jinja2/environment.py", line 669, in render
    return self.environment.handle_exception(exc_info, True)
File "<template>", line 12, in top-level template code
UnicodeDecodeError: 'ascii' codec can't decode byte 0xe5 in position 14: ordinal not in range(128)

; line 12

---
[...]
    - user: root
页: [1]
查看完整版本: salt-stack pillar中传中文报错